  11. I'm 5 months post op today and I almost forgot about the gas until I saw this thread. It is by far the worse part of this journey so far. It also it the part the the surgeons mention the least. The gas isn't in your intestines. It's what they use to blow up your abdomen so they can work on you laparoscopically. Did you know they did that? i sure didn't! The remaining gas can only be removed as it dissipates through your skin tissue. GasX never worked for me. Moving and heat did. Great news is that it will go away deepening on how much you move between 4-10 days.

  13. Patience is the key. Also, this journey is not about losing weight right out of surgery. It's about living a healthy lifestyle. The weight comes off on its own. So my device is to get out of the way and let the band and your dr do their jobs. You will be amazed. I'm 5 months out tomorrow and I can gulp liquids, eat big bites, eat a lot of food, be hungry after 1 hr, but.... I sip, eat small bites, portion food out to 1c and 850 cal a day, and work on moving more. I've been really successful. Can't wait to feel the fill. I haven't updated my ticker yet. Last fill was feb 25. I have 7 ccs in the realize band (14cc) and I'm 212 today. (From 276) Good luck to you!
